Managing InformationTechnology as a Strategic Resource (Paperback) by WILLCOCKS

Derived from well proven teaching material this book will provide essential reading for students taking the core subject of Information Management. The new Oxford MBA has only recently agreed Information Management as a core subject but it is already an integral part of the MBA course in other business schools. The Oxford Institute of Information Management has for many years provided an IM input for the MBA and executive courses at Templeton College. The various teaching modules, sixteen in all, constitute a significant part of the MBA course, all of which have been taught and refined over the last few years. Conveniently they form the chapters for the book.

Table of Contents

Information Technology: Leveraging the Business. Does Your CIO Add Value? Understanding the CEO-CIO Relationship. Information Technology as a Basis for Sustainable Competitive Advantage. In Search of IT Productivity: Assessment Issues. Decision Support Systems for Strategic Decision Making and Performance Measurement. Organising for Development and Delivery. Configuring the IS Organisation in Complex Organisations. Information Systems Organisation. Roles of Users and Specialists. Managing Strategic Technology Projects. The Development and Implementation of Systems. Bridging the User-IS Gap. Management and Risk Issues in Major IT Projects. Does Radical Re-engineering Really Work? Recent Case Evidence. Sourcing Information Technology. The Value of Selective IT Sourcing. IT Outsourcing in Europe and the USA: Assessment Issues. Emerging Technology Issues. Gaining Value from Information Architecture: Research Based Recommendations for the Practitioner: Implementing Client Server: Key Trends: Capabilities and Learning. The IT Function: Changing Capabilities and Skills. The Five Year Learning of Ten IT Directors.
